L T Foods' Q3 FY 2025-26 Quarterly Results
- 29 Jan 2026
Result Summary
- L T Foods Ltd reported a 1.4% quarter-on-quarter (QoQ) increase in its consolidated revenues for the quarter-ended Dec (Q3 FY 2025-26). On a year-on-year (YoY) basis, it witnessed a growth of 22.9%.
- Its expenses for the quarter were up by 1.9% QoQ and 23.8% YoY.
- The net profit decreased 4.0% QoQ and increased 8.2% YoY.
- The earnings per share (EPS) of L T Foods Ltd stood at 4.53 during Q3 FY 2025-26.

Company Overview
L T Foods Ltd is a prominent player in the agribusiness sector, primarily engaged in the production, processing, and marketing of branded rice and rice-based food products. The company has a strong presence in both domestic and international markets, offering a diverse range of products that cater to various consumer preferences. L T Foods is well-known for its flagship brand, Daawat, which is a leader in the premium basmati rice segment. Revenue
The financial data for L T Foods Ltd shows a total income of ₹2,811.95 crores for Q3FY26, representing a quarter-over-quarter (QoQ) increase of 1.4% compared to ₹2,772.48 crores in Q2FY26. This also marks a year-over-year (YoY) growth of 22.9% from ₹2,288.26 crores in Q3FY25. This consistent increase in total income indicates a strong growth trajectory over the past year. Profitability
In terms of profitability, L T Foods Ltd reported a Profit Before Tax (PBT) of ₹219.26 crores in Q3FY26, which shows a decrease of 4.0% QoQ from ₹228.29 crores in Q2FY26. Nevertheless, this represents a YoY increase of 13.1% from ₹193.83 crores in Q3FY25. The Profit After Tax (PAT) for Q3FY26 stands at ₹157.35 crores, down 4.0% QoQ from ₹163.85 crores in the previous quarter, but up 8.2% YoY from ₹145.39 crores in Q3FY25. The earnings per share (EPS) also reflect similar trends, with a decrease of 4.0% QoQ to ₹4.53, and a YoY increase of 9.7% from ₹4.13. Operating Metrics
The total expenses for L T Foods Ltd in Q3FY26 amounted to ₹2,592.70 crores, which is a 1.9% increase from ₹2,544.20 crores in Q2FY26 and a 23.8% rise from ₹2,094.43 crores in Q3FY25. This indicates that while the company has experienced robust revenue growth, it has also seen a proportional increase in expenses. The relationship between revenue, expenses, and profits is crucial for understanding the company's operational efficiency and cost management practices. The tax expense for the quarter was ₹63.02 crores, a slight decrease of 3.4% QoQ from ₹65.27 crores, but an increase of 20.2% YoY from ₹52.45 crores.
